I was wondering if I was being charged WiFi access when my e-mail checks itself in the Messaging center? I have an HTC Mogul and it pops up as saying dialing #777. Is this just a normal connection or is it WiFi? I hope this made some sort of sense.

knytphal
01-07-2008, 08:09 PM
That's the phone connecting to the power vision network. It's normal. You did get a data package, did you not?

Also, I don't think that you'll ever be charged for 'WiFi' access, unless your using somebody's hotspot that you need to pay for.
